Product Description:
Natalie Portman, Joseph Gordon-Levitt, and Rainn Wilson star in this comedy that has a bleak beginning. Teenage TJ is struggling to get through adolescence without setting himself on fire, not to mention mourning the recent death of his mother. Enter Hesher, who seems as maladjusted as TJ but may have something to teach him about life.
